Joseph-hilaire is a compound name combining 'Joseph,' from the Hebrew Yosef meaning 'God will add' or 'God increases,' and 'Hilaire,' derived from the Latin 'Hilarius,' meaning cheerful or happy. The name blends spiritual hope with joyful brightness, reflecting a legacy of faith and positivity that has been cherished in Christian and French traditions.

Cultural Significance of Joseph-hilaire

The name Joseph-hilaire reflects a rich cultural blend, especially prominent in French-speaking regions where compound names honor religious and virtuous qualities. 'Joseph' has biblical roots as the favored son of Jacob and a figure symbolizing faith and perseverance. 'Hilaire' recalls Saint Hilaire, a 4th-century bishop known for his theological contributions and cheerful spirit. Together, the name evokes spiritual strength and joyful character, often seen in historical Catholic communities.

Joseph Hilaire Pierre René Belloc

French-English writer and historian, known for his prolific works in literature and social commentary.

Joseph Hilaire Camille Lenoir

French politician and member of parliament during the 19th century, influential in regional politics.

Joseph Hilaire Amédée d’Espinassy

French nobleman and military officer, notable for his service in the 19th century.
